首页
/ 3步完成Axure RP界面本地化:从原理到实践的完整指南

3步完成Axure RP界面本地化:从原理到实践的完整指南

2026-04-25 10:49:08作者:谭伦延

软件汉化与界面本地化是提升设计效率的关键环节,尤其对于Axure RP这类专业原型设计工具而言。本文将系统讲解如何安全、高效地将Axure RP 9/10/11版本界面转换为中文,帮助用户消除语言障碍,提升设计流畅度。无论你是原型设计新手还是有经验的用户,通过本文的本地化方案,都能快速掌握界面中文化的核心方法与维护技巧。

🔍 问题溯源:Axure界面本地化失败深度解析

常见汉化失败场景对比表

失败场景 典型表现 技术根源 发生率
文件版本不匹配 软件启动崩溃 语言文件与Axure版本号不对应 ★★★☆☆
权限配置错误 部分菜单仍为英文 语言文件未获得读取权限 ★★☆☆☆
进程未完全退出 替换后无变化 系统锁定原语言文件 ★★★☆☆
目录结构错误 界面显示混乱 语言文件放置路径不正确 ★★☆☆☆
系统版本冲突 功能异常 macOS版本低于10.15不支持新特性 ★☆☆☆☆

Axure RP的语言文件采用层级目录结构,不同版本(9/10/11)的语言包不能混用。许多用户在汉化时直接替换lang文件夹却忽略版本匹配,导致界面元素错乱或软件无法启动。你是否曾因未验证语言文件版本而导致汉化失败?

🛠️ 环境适配:系统与软件兼容性检测指南

系统版本兼容性矩阵

Axure版本 最低macOS版本 推荐macOS版本 支持架构
Axure 9 10.12 (Sierra) 10.14 (Mojave) Intel
Axure 10 10.15 (Catalina) 11 (Big Sur) Intel/M1
Axure 11 11 (Big Sur) 12 (Monterey) Intel/M1/M2

兼容性验证命令

# 检查macOS版本
sw_vers -productVersion

# 查看Axure版本
defaults read /Applications/Axure\ RP\ 11.app/Contents/Info CFBundleShortVersionString

在进行界面本地化前,务必通过上述命令确认系统环境是否满足要求。对于搭载Apple Silicon芯片的Mac用户,Axure 10及以上版本需运行在Rosetta 2转译模式下。你的设备是否已经做好这些兼容性准备?

📋 实施蓝图:Axure界面中文化三步操作法

准备阶段(难度系数:★☆☆)

操作目的:确保环境安全与资源就绪
具体方法

  1. 完全退出Axure RP所有进程(包括后台进程)
  2. 通过活动监视器验证Axure相关进程已终止
  3. 克隆语言包仓库:
    git clone https://gitcode.com/gh_mirrors/ax/axure-cn
    

预期结果:本地获得完整的Axure多版本语言包资源

⚠️ 风险预警:未完全退出Axure会导致文件替换失败,建议使用killall "Axure RP 11"命令强制终止进程

操作阶段(难度系数:★★☆)

操作目的:安全替换语言文件
具体方法

  1. 定位应用目录:
    open /Applications/Axure\ RP\ 11.app/Contents/MacOS
    
  2. 备份原始语言文件:
    mv lang lang_backup
    
  3. 复制对应版本的汉化文件:
    cp -r axure-cn/Axure\ 11/lang /Applications/Axure\ RP\ 11.app/Contents/MacOS/
    

预期结果:新的语言文件成功替换并保持正确权限

⚠️ 风险预警:错误的目录路径会导致汉化失败,请仔细核对Axure版本号与语言包目录名称是否一致

验证阶段(难度系数:★☆☆)

操作目的:确认界面完全中文化
具体方法

  1. 重新启动Axure RP
  2. 依次检查主菜单、工具栏及对话框
  3. 执行基本操作验证功能完整性 预期结果:所有界面元素均显示为中文,功能正常

Axure RP 11汉化界面 Axure RP 11汉化界面展示,主菜单与功能区均已完全中文化

你是否建立了自己的软件修改验证流程?一个全面的验证步骤能有效避免后续使用中的潜在问题。

✅ 效果审计:本地化质量评估体系

全面检查清单

  1. 主界面验证

    • 菜单栏:文件、编辑、视图等所有主菜单
    • 工具栏:所有工具按钮提示文本
    • 属性面板:所有选项与描述文字
  2. 功能对话框验证

    • 新建文件对话框
    • 偏好设置面板
    • 发布设置窗口
  3. 错误提示验证

    • 操作错误提示信息
    • 保存冲突警告
    • 权限不足提示

Axure RP 10汉化界面 Axure RP 10汉化界面效果,展示早期版本的本地化质量

如果发现部分界面仍为英文,可尝试删除语言缓存文件后重新启动:

rm -rf ~/Library/Caches/com.axure.AxureRP

你通常会特别关注哪些界面元素的本地化质量?

🔄 长效方案:本地化维护与版本管理

本地化维护日历

维护周期 关键任务 工具支持
每月 检查语言包更新 git pull
Axure更新前 备份当前语言文件 自定义shell脚本
更新后24小时内 验证本地化状态 功能测试清单
每季度 清理语言缓存 系统清理工具

版本管理脚本示例

#!/bin/bash
# Axure本地化备份脚本
VERSION=$(defaults read /Applications/Axure\ RP\ 11.app/Contents/Info CFBundleShortVersionString)
BACKUP_DIR=~/Documents/axure_lang_backups/$VERSION
mkdir -p $BACKUP_DIR
cp -r /Applications/Axure\ RP\ 11.app/Contents/MacOS/lang $BACKUP_DIR
echo "已备份Axure $VERSION语言文件至$BACKUP_DIR"

通过建立这样的维护机制,可确保Axure更新后能快速恢复本地化设置。你更倾向于使用自动化工具还是手动方式管理软件配置?

💡 效能提升:本地化界面优化指南

字体优化方案

操作目的:提升中文显示清晰度
具体方法

  1. 关闭Axure RP
  2. 编辑配置文件:
    open ~/Library/Application Support/Axure RP 11/Axure.ini
    
  3. 添加字体配置:
    [Fonts]
    InterfaceFont=PingFang SC
    InterfaceFontSize=12
    

预期结果:界面字体更适合中文阅读,减少视觉疲劳

快捷键定制建议

根据中文操作习惯优化的快捷键方案:

  • 常用操作:文件保存 (⌘S)、撤销 (⌘Z)
  • 原型操作:添加注释 (⌘/ )、生成原型 (⌘Shift+P)
  • 视图操作:放大 (⌘+)、缩小 (⌘-)

社区资源导航

  • 语言包更新渠道:项目GitHub仓库issues
  • 问题反馈路径:Axure中文社区论坛
  • 技术支持群组:Axure设计交流QQ群

这些资源能帮助你及时获取最新的本地化支持。你还有哪些提升Axure使用效率的小技巧?

通过本文介绍的系统化方案,你不仅能够顺利完成Axure RP的界面本地化,还能建立可持续的维护机制。随着对Axure的深入使用,建议定期回顾并优化你的本地化配置,让工具始终保持最佳工作状态。现在,准备好用中文版Axure RP创建你的下一个出色原型了吗?

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
docsdocs
暂无描述
Dockerfile
702
4.51 K
pytorchpytorch
Ascend Extension for PyTorch
Python
566
693
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
546
98
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
957
955
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
411
338
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.6 K
940
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
566
AscendNPU-IRAscendNPU-IR
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
128
210
flutter_flutterflutter_flutter
暂无简介
Dart
948
235
Oohos_react_native
React Native鸿蒙化仓库
C++
340
387